Transaction 70d763317818658b50c49f736af0c9dae83f5c1fc168995d1e13ea51132103ff

2 Input
2 Outputs
  • 70d763317818658b50c49f736af0c9dae83f5c1fc168995d1e13ea51132103ff:0
  • value  6897499
    address  39BpwRsDwo35DqjGFqpeEVebjTJutrhp6n
  • 70d763317818658b50c49f736af0c9dae83f5c1fc168995d1e13ea51132103ff:1
  • value  1005889
    address  1LMh6WFU2VU6Nymfx7XiWU2qQm5dPmpvsC